How much do remote animation script writing jobs pay per hour?

As of May 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for remote animation script writing in Matthews, NC is $37.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.58 and $60.10 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Animation Script Writer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Animation Script Writer, you need strong storytelling abilities, a solid grasp of script formatting, and experience in animation writing, often supported by a degree in creative writing, film, or a related field. Familiarity with industry-standard screenwriting software like Final Draft or Celtx is typically required. Creativity, self-motivation, and effective remote communication skills help writers collaborate with animation teams and adapt to feedback. These skills ensure scripts are engaging, production-ready, and align with the creative vision, which is crucial for successful animated projects.

How do remote animation script writers typically collaborate with animation teams during the production process?

Remote animation script writers usually work closely with directors, storyboard artists, and producers through virtual meetings, cloud-based script editing tools, and messaging platforms. Effective communication is essential to ensure the script aligns with the project's visual style and pacing. Writers often participate in feedback sessions, making revisions based on team input and adapting to changes in storyboards or animation direction. Building strong, proactive relationships with creative team members helps maintain a smooth workflow despite the physical distance.

What is remote animation script writing?

Remote animation script writing involves creating scripts for animated productions, such as TV shows, movies, or web series, while working from a location outside of a traditional studio environment. Writers collaborate with directors, animators, and producers through digital communication tools to develop storylines, dialogue, and scene directions tailored for animation. This role requires strong storytelling skills, an understanding of animation pacing, and the ability to adapt scripts for visual storytelling. Working remotely offers flexibility but also demands self-discipline and effective communication to meet project deadlines.

What is the difference between Remote Animation Script Writing vs Remote Storyboarding?

AspectRemote Animation Script WritingRemote Storyboarding
Required skillsWriting, storytelling, script developmentVisual storytelling, drawing, scene planning
Work environmentCollaborative with writers and animatorsVisual artists, animators, directors
Industry usageFilm, TV, online content, advertisingAnimation, film production, advertising

Remote Animation Script Writing involves creating dialogue and story structure for animations, focusing on narrative flow. Remote Storyboarding involves visualizing scenes through sketches, planning camera angles and scene composition. Both roles often collaborate but differ in their focus: one on writing, the other on visual planning. Understanding these differences helps employers and freelancers identify the right role for their project needs.
